Cookies on this site

This site uses cookies to store information on your computer. By using our site you accept the terms of our Privacy and Cookie Policy

Accept and close
 
Menu
EK4A2513 Edited 963X150px
Careers
 

Chief Executive Officer, CTMA (London, Portsoken Street)

Charles Taylor plc is a global leading provider of professional services to the insurance industry. The group manages mutual insurance companies, provides specialist loss adjusting services, has recently set up a Lloyd’s Managing Agency and syndicate and is a provider of a diverse range of outsourced management and technical insurance services for the global market. 

Charles Taylor currently employs over 1800 staff working in over 71 offices in 28 countries worldwide.  In London we employ approximately 600 staff working across 3 offices in Central London.  We are a profitable, growing organisation that is highly regarded in the insurance industry as a top tier provider of professional services, employing some of the industry’s ‘best in class’ professionals and technical experts.  Our delivery of high quality, individually tailored services to our clients is backed by our core values of excellence, partnership, quality and support, and we look for employees to join us who exemplify these values and our ethos.  

Overall Purpose of the Job

The CEO is responsible for the strategic and operational running of the CTMA turnkey business.  The primary role includes:

  • Providing a high quality service to existing syndicate clients
  • Ensuring that the appropriate controls and oversight for existing syndicate clients are in place and working effectively (in line with what would be expected of a turnkey managing agency CEO)
  • Providing leadership to and management of the turnkey managing agency’s employees
  • Overseeing the development and maintenance of relationships with CTMA’s investors and key internal and external stakeholders
  • Working collaboratively with the Managing Director of The Standard Syndicate and the MD’s of any future syndicates under CTMA’s management, who are responsible for each syndicate’s operations, to facilitate the success of both the turnkey managing agency and that of the syndicates.
  • Winning and onboarding new syndicate clients who have appointed CTMA to provide turnkey managing agency services to them

Key Responsibilities 

  • Liaise directly between the Board and management of the Company
  • Establish and ensure delivery of a specific strategy and policy for CTMA in all areas of its business, and communicate the strategy with all stakeholders of the business
  • Responsible for apportionment and oversight to ensure a suitable corporate structure is in place to deliver the corporate governance requirements of the company
  • Seek the agreement of the Board to the proposed strategy and ensure the communication and implementation of the agreed strategy and business plan.
  • Identify and develop opportunities for CTMA to develop, liaising with investors and third parties effectively
  • Ensure that the Directors are properly informed and that sufficient information is provided to the Board to enable Directors to form appropriate judgments
  • Provide leadership to the CTMA ExCo team.  Ensure the team are effectively mentored, managed and supported to achieve their best results.  Work effectively with the group HR team to effectively recruit, develop and manage the team as well as ensure succession plans are managed effectively for key senior roles
  • Take an overview on risk and compliance issues and to ensure the continuance of positive and consistent risk and compliance results.  Ensure effective liaison with relevant legislative and regulatory bodies
  • Ensure the integrity of all public disclosure by the Company. Work collaboratively with other businesses in the Charles Taylor group, identifying opportunities to work together
  • Keep abreast of the material undertakings and activities of the Company and all material external factors affecting the Company and to ensure that processes and systems are in place to ensure that the CEO and management are adequately informed

Culture & Business Model

  • Lead the development of the firm’s culture by the governing body as whole.
  • Lead the development of the firm’s culture and standards in relation to the carrying on of its business and the behaviours of its staff
  • Act as a role model and encourage appropriate behaviours throughout CTMA
  • Take responsibility for the management and embedding of the firm’s culture and standards in relation to the carrying on of its business and the behaviours of staff in the day-to-day management of the firm

Additional key responsibilities

  • Build and maintain good relationships at all appropriate levels in Lloyd’s
  • Fulfil, as an approved person, the role of Chief Executive Officer (SIMF 1) in accordance with the Senior Insurance Managers Regime
  • Maintain an awareness of the regulatory environment in which CTMA, as a Lloyd’s managing agent, operates
  • Develop and maintain the firm’s business model by the governing body
  • Ensure that the syndicate(s) provide(s) CTMA with the appropriate level of comfort regarding the approach to risk and the commitment to achieving the best outcomes for all the syndicates’ policyholders
  • Carry out duties in accordance with applicable standards set out in the Prudential Regulation Authority Rulebook and the Financial Conduct Authority Handbook 

Ad Hoc Duties 

Your key accountabilities will include such other duties and tasks are as allocated to you at the discretion of management and that are within your capabilities and within the scope of your post. 

Essential Skills/Qualifications/Experience 

  • Significant level of industry experience in an executive role with experience of leading operations, strategy, finances and teams
  • Demonstrable leadership skills, with proven track record at senior management level
  • Excellent people management and communication skills
  • Sound business development skills and a proven track record of developing business successfully
  • In-depth knowledge of the insurance sector and operations (preferable)
  • Exceptional financial and commercial acumen
  • Excellent knowledge of relevant legislative framework
  • Ability to scale a business 

Apply for a role at Charles Taylor

To apply please send us an email: recruitment@ctplc.com

Please include your name, email address, phone number and CV and tell us in a few words why you would like to apply for the role.